Transaction 02c62a594f8bf30a617059b34f09491f53e8c069024fde0bde2b7bbc1356ae38
1 Input
1 Output
-
02c62a594f8bf30a617059b34f09491f53e8c069024fde0bde2b7bbc1356ae38:0
- value
- 308160
- script pubkey
- OP_0 OP_PUSHBYTES_20 e61d083b8498478bb64bcef94421c6bbe0adff1c
- address
- bc1qucwsswuynprchdjtemu5ggwxh0s2mlcupgxups